
cmpsz_test1:
.flags = strings.flagCHARTBL
.charTbl: rb 512
.charTblSrc: ub '../inc/string/emul_xxxx tables/emul_xxxx.win1251',0
ReadFileA(.charTbl .charTblSrc 0 512)
.sz1: ub 'board.flatassembler.net',0
.sz2: ub 'board.FlatAssembler.net',0
if cmpsz(.flags .charTbl .sz1 .sz2)
  pause 'equal'
end if


cmpsz_test2:
.flags = strings.flagCHARTBL + strings.flagUNICODE
align 4
.charTbl: rb 65'536
.charTblSrc: ub '../inc/string/emul_xxxx tables/emul_xxxx.unicode',0
ReadFileA(.charTbl .charTblSrc 0 65'536)
.sz1: ui16 'F','A','S','M' ,0
.sz2: ui16 'f','a','s','m' ,0

if cmpsz(.flags .charTbl .sz1 .sz2)
  pause 'equal'
end if
